diff options
| author | TheSiahxyz <164138827+TheSiahxyz@users.noreply.github.com> | 2025-08-28 08:51:20 +0900 |
|---|---|---|
| committer | TheSiahxyz <164138827+TheSiahxyz@users.noreply.github.com> | 2025-08-28 08:51:37 +0900 |
| commit | c8892cc179733a0d44711cced9b51ce806bae086 (patch) | |
| tree | 2890021bd00a78f38116a2255c257216ffa232d7 /mac | |
| parent | f1ad1dbe1194681c1aa20493b5555bb161a047c9 (diff) | |
changes
Diffstat (limited to 'mac')
| -rw-r--r-- | mac/.config/aerospace/aerospace.toml | 34 | ||||
| -rw-r--r-- | mac/.config/kitty/kitty.conf | 2 | ||||
| -rw-r--r-- | mac/.config/lf/icons | 4 | ||||
| -rw-r--r-- | mac/.config/shell/profile | 11 | ||||
| -rw-r--r-- | mac/.config/zsh/scripts.zsh | 2 |
5 files changed, 38 insertions, 15 deletions
diff --git a/mac/.config/aerospace/aerospace.toml b/mac/.config/aerospace/aerospace.toml index 0737240..febfc9e 100644 --- a/mac/.config/aerospace/aerospace.toml +++ b/mac/.config/aerospace/aerospace.toml @@ -106,13 +106,16 @@ on-focus-changed = ['move-mouse window-lazy-center'] # You can uncomment this line to open up terminal with alt + enter shortcut # See: https://nikitabobko.github.io/AeroSpace/commands#exec-and-forget # alt-enter = 'exec-and-forget open -n /System/Applications/Utilities/Terminal.app' - alt-enter = 'exec-and-forget open -n /Applications/Kitty.app' - alt-c = 'exec-and-forget kitty --title "calcurse" -e calcurse' + alt-enter = 'exec-and-forget open -na Kitty' + alt-shift-enter = 'exec-and-forget open -na Cursor' + alt-ctrl-enter = 'exec-and-forget open -na "Visual Studio Code"' + alt-c = 'exec-and-forget kitty --title -o close_on_child_death=yes -o confirm_os_window_close=0 "calcurse" -e calcurse' alt-d = 'exec-and-forget open -na Dbeaver' - alt-e = 'exec-and-forget kitty --title "neomutt" -e env EDITOR="nvim -u ~/.config/nvim/init.lua" neomutt' + alt-e = 'exec-and-forget kitty --title -o close_on_child_death=yes -o confirm_os_window_close=0 "neomutt" -e env EDITOR="nvim -u ~/.config/nvim/init.lua" neomutt' alt-shift-e = 'exec-and-forget open -na "Microsoft Outlook"' - alt-r = 'exec-and-forget kitty --title "htop" -e htop' - alt-s = 'exec-and-forget kitty --title "newsboat" -e newsboat' + alt-o = 'exec-and-forget open -na Docker' + alt-r = 'exec-and-forget kitty --title -o close_on_child_death=yes -o confirm_os_window_close=0 "htop" -e htop' + alt-s = 'exec-and-forget kitty --title -o close_on_child_death=yes -o confirm_os_window_close=0 "newsboat" -e newsboat' alt-t = 'exec-and-forget open -na "Microsoft Teams"' alt-w = 'exec-and-forget open -na Firefox' @@ -146,6 +149,7 @@ on-focus-changed = ['move-mouse window-lazy-center'] alt-7 = 'workspace 7' alt-8 = 'workspace 8' alt-9 = 'workspace 9' + alt-0 = 'workspace 10' # See: https://nikitabobko.github.io/AeroSpace/commands#move-node-to-workspace alt-shift-1 = 'move-node-to-workspace 1' @@ -157,6 +161,7 @@ on-focus-changed = ['move-mouse window-lazy-center'] alt-shift-7 = 'move-node-to-workspace 7' alt-shift-8 = 'move-node-to-workspace 8' alt-shift-9 = 'move-node-to-workspace 9' + alt-shift-0 = 'move-node-to-workspace 10' # See: https://nikitabobko.github.io/AeroSpace/commands#move-node-to-workspace alt-ctrl-1 = ['move-node-to-workspace 1', 'workspace 1'] @@ -168,6 +173,7 @@ on-focus-changed = ['move-mouse window-lazy-center'] alt-ctrl-7 = ['move-node-to-workspace 7', 'workspace 7'] alt-ctrl-8 = ['move-node-to-workspace 8', 'workspace 8'] alt-ctrl-9 = ['move-node-to-workspace 9', 'workspace 9'] + alt-ctrl-0 = ['move-node-to-workspace 10', 'workspace 10'] # See: https://nikitabobko.github.io/AeroSpace/commands#workspace-back-and-forth alt-tab = 'workspace-back-and-forth' @@ -242,6 +248,10 @@ if.app-id = 'com.clickup.desktop-app' run = ['move-node-to-workspace 5'] [[on-window-detected]] +if.app-id = 'com.electron.dockerdesktop' +run = ['move-node-to-workspace 6'] + +[[on-window-detected]] if.app-name-regex-substring = 'vimwiki' run = ['move-node-to-workspace 6'] @@ -262,17 +272,21 @@ if.app-id = 'com.apple.iCal' run = ['move-node-to-workspace 8'] [[on-window-detected]] -if.app-id = 'com.kakao.KakaoTalkMac' +if.app-id = 'com.microsoft.Outlook' run = ['move-node-to-workspace 9'] [[on-window-detected]] -if.app-id = 'com.tdesktop.Telegram' +if.app-id = 'com.microsoft.teams2' run = ['move-node-to-workspace 9'] [[on-window-detected]] +if.app-id = 'com.kakao.KakaoTalkMac' +run = ['move-node-to-workspace 10'] + +[[on-window-detected]] if.app-id = 'com.hnc.Discord' -run = ['move-node-to-workspace 9'] +run = ['move-node-to-workspace 10'] [[on-window-detected]] -if.app-id = 'com.microsoft.teams2' -run = ['move-node-to-workspace 9'] +if.app-id = 'com.tdesktop.Telegram' +run = ['move-node-to-workspace 10'] diff --git a/mac/.config/kitty/kitty.conf b/mac/.config/kitty/kitty.conf index 719e760..d77c33b 100644 --- a/mac/.config/kitty/kitty.conf +++ b/mac/.config/kitty/kitty.conf @@ -6,7 +6,7 @@ #: individual font faces and even specify special fonts for particular #: characters. -font_family FiraCode Nerd Font +font_family FiraCode Nerd Font Mono # bold_font auto # italic_font auto # bold_italic_font auto diff --git a/mac/.config/lf/icons b/mac/.config/lf/icons index 9792436..0464ef4 100644 --- a/mac/.config/lf/icons +++ b/mac/.config/lf/icons @@ -23,9 +23,9 @@ Vagrantfile *.ejs *.css *.less -*.md +*.md *.mdx -*.markdown +*.markdown *.rmd *.json *.webmanifest diff --git a/mac/.config/shell/profile b/mac/.config/shell/profile index 5549050..963e64d 100644 --- a/mac/.config/shell/profile +++ b/mac/.config/shell/profile @@ -3,9 +3,10 @@ ################################################### # Add all directories in each subdirectory to $PATH export PATH="$PATH:/opt/homebrew/bin" -export PATH="$PATH:$(find -L /opt/homebrew/opt -name bin -type d -print 2>/dev/null | sort -u | paste -s -d ':' -)" +export PATH="$PATH:$(find -L ~/.local/share/asdf/installs -name bin -type d -print 2>/dev/null | sort -u | paste -s -d ':' -)" export PATH="$PATH:$(find ~/.local/bin -path '*/.git*' -prune -o \( -type f -o -type l \) -perm -u=x -exec dirname {} \; | sort -u | paste -sd ':' -)" export PATH="$PATH:$(find ~/.local/share/.password-store -type d -name '.extensions' | paste -sd ':' -)" +command -v asdf >/dev/null 2>&1 && export PATH="$PATH:$(find -L /opt/homebrew/opt -name bin -type d -print 2>/dev/null | sort -u | paste -s -d ':' -)" unsetopt PROMPT_SP 2>/dev/null @@ -54,6 +55,10 @@ export ANDROID_SDK_HOME="$XDG_CONFIG_HOME/android" ### --- ANSIBLE --- ### export ANSIBLE_CONFIG="$XDG_CONFIG_HOME/ansible/ansible.cfg" +### --- ASDF --- ### +export ASDF_CONFIG_FILE="$XDG_CONFIG_HOME/asdf/asdfrc" +export ASDF_DATA_DIR="$XDG_DATA_HOME/asdf" + ### --- BAT --- ### export BAT_CONFIG_PATH="$XDG_CONFIG_HOME/bat/config" @@ -63,6 +68,10 @@ export CARGO_HOME="$XDG_DATA_HOME/cargo" ### --- DICS --- ### export DICS="/usr/share/stardict/dic/" +### --- DOCKER --- ### +export DOCKER_CONFIG="$XDG_CONFIG_HOME"/docker +export MACHINE_STORAGE_PATH="$XDG_DATA_HOME"/docker-machine + ### --- ELECTRUM --- ### export ELECTRUMDIR="$XDG_DATA_HOME/electrum" diff --git a/mac/.config/zsh/scripts.zsh b/mac/.config/zsh/scripts.zsh index 42c60fc..7ebe2ed 100644 --- a/mac/.config/zsh/scripts.zsh +++ b/mac/.config/zsh/scripts.zsh @@ -466,7 +466,7 @@ function fzf_kill_process() { # open lf and cd to the file path function lfcd () { tmp="$(mktemp -uq)" - trap 'rm -f $tmp >/dev/null 2>&1 && trap - HUP INT QUIT TERM PWR EXIT' HUP INT QUIT TERM PWR EXIT + trap 'rm -f $tmp >/dev/null 2>&1 && trap - HUP INT QUIT TERM EXIT' HUP INT QUIT TERM EXIT lf -last-dir-path="$tmp" "$@" if [ -f "$tmp" ]; then dir="$(cat "$tmp")" |
